Etymology

[edit]

Inherited from Ashokan Prakrit *𑀟𑀩𑁆𑀩 (*ḍabba), *𑀟𑀸𑀯 (*ḍāva, box; hollow vessel); possibly ultimately of Dravidian origin.[1] Compare डिब्बा (ḍibbā, box), Marathi डाव (ḍāv, hollowed coconut), Bengali ডাব (ḍbo), Odia ଡାବ (ḍāba, raw coconut). Also compare Swahili dafu, an Indo-Aryan borrowing.

Noun

[edit]

डाब (ḍābm (Urdu spelling ڈاب)

  1. green coconut
